Track Lock System

The Track Lock System has been load tested by Loughborough University with brilliant results. In all of the tests the Track Lock System acts as an extra safety feature to cater for dynamic loads such as pot holes, clipping curbs etc. The cross beams hold the excavator in place.
The excavator is loaded with blade facing forwards. The Track Lock System bars are then placed across the tracks and clipped into place using a lynch pin.

Guide Bars are fixed to the trailer bed to allow for correct positioning of the excavator on the trailer. |

The Tracks cannot move and the excavator is totally locked down. This system can be altered to fit any make of mini excavator. |

The breaker carrier removes manual handling issues.
Allows for safe transportation.
Acts as an anti theft device as the breaker can be locked down |

The ditching bucket is put into the front cradle which stops any movement from the boom. |
The excavator is completely locked down, positioned correctly and is balanced on the trailer to allow for safe transportation.
The bars are easily put in place and easily removed making this an efficient, operator friendly and time saving system.

TRACK LOCK NEWS
We have already supplied numerous utility companies with the Patented Track Lock System which has already proved itself
out in the field.
One of our customers was involved in an incident where a hitch failed and released the trailer
from the vehicle towing it, the trailer hit and bounced up the kerb and through a fence.
The 1.5 tonne excavator on
the trailer did not come off, tip or move at all, the Track Lock System kept it securely locked down and attached to the trailer.
If the trailer had been using straps to secure the excavator there is no question it would have fallen off and the incident could
of potentially been much more serious.
